Call for Proposals | Innovative solutions for resilient and climate-adapted coastal communities in the Atlantic

Horizon call

HORIZON-CL6-2025-02-COMMUNITIES-03
Deadline: 16 September 2025
Total Budget: €6 million

The European Commission has launched a funding opportunity under Horizon Europe Cluster 6 to support resilient, inclusive, healthy, and green coastal communities. This call invites innovative, interdisciplinary proposals that address the unique challenges and opportunities faced by coastal regions in the context of climate change, biodiversity loss, and socio-economic transformation.

Call Focus:

  • Foster sustainable development in coastal areas.

  • Promote nature-based solutions and community-led innovation.

  • Enhance climate resiliencebiodiversity protection, and social inclusion.

  • Support local governanceparticipatory planning, and circular economy models.

Who Should Apply?

This call is ideal for:

  • Research institutions and universities

  • Local and regional authorities

  • NGOs and civil society organizations

  • SMEs and industry partners

  • Coastal community networks

Proposals must demonstrate a transdisciplinary approach, involving both scientific and local knowledge, and should include co-creation with communities to ensure relevance and impact.

Key Dates

  • Proposal Deadline: 16 September 2025

  • Evaluation Results: February 2026

  • Project Start: June 2026

How to Apply

Applications must be submitted via the Funding & Tenders Portal. This is a single-stage call, so applicants must submit a complete proposal by the deadline.
